Sat 518187676531304

decimal
103637.2676531304
degree
0°103637′821″2676531304‴
percentile
24.675603671490986%
name
kehskkayblp
cycle
0
epoch
0
period
51
block
103637
offset
2676531304
timestamp
rarity
common